Choosing the Right Sports Jersey: Your Ultimate Buying Guide

Choosing the sports jersey involves a mix of practicality, comfort and style. Whether you’re an athlete, a hard fan or just someone who enjoys staying active finding the right jersey can greatly improve your overall experience. This detailed guide will take you through the factors to keep in mind when selecting the sports jersey.

Know Your Requirements:-

  • Athletic Wear, vs. Everyday Use

Athletic Wear; – If you intend to use the jersey for sports or exercise focus on performance aspects such as moisture wicking capabilities, breathability and flexibility.
Everyday Use; – For fans or casual wearers, style and comfort may be more important. Look for jerseys that show support, for your team or player while ensuring a fit.

Specific Sport Requirements

Different sports have varying demands. For instance:

  • Basketball Jerseys: Usually sleeveless to allow maximum arm movement.
  • Soccer Jerseys: Often made from lightweight materials to keep players cool and dry.
  • Cycling Jerseys: Designed to be tight-fitting and aerodynamic with pockets for storage.

Material Matters

Common Materials

  • Polyester: Highly popular due to its durability, lightweight nature, and moisture-wicking properties.
  • Cotton: Comfortable and breathable but retains sweat, making it less ideal for high-intensity activities.
  • Blends: A mix of materials like polyester and spandex can offer both comfort and performance benefits.

Advanced Fabrics

  • Dri-FIT (Nike): Specialized fabric that wicks moisture away from the body.
  • Climacool (Adidas): Enhances ventilation and moisture management.
  • Coolmax: Known for excellent breathability and moisture-wicking capabilities.

Fit and Comfort

Sizing

  • Ensure the jersey fits well without being too tight or too loose. An ill-fitting jersey can restrict movement and cause discomfort.
  • Consider trying on jerseys or checking size charts provided by manufacturers, as sizing can vary.

Style and Cut

  • Men’s vs. Women’s Cut: Jerseys often come in gender-specific cuts to better fit different body types.
  • Slim Fit vs. Regular Fit: Slim-fit jerseys offer a modern, snug look, while regular-fit jerseys provide a more relaxed feel.

Features

  • Seam Placement: Look for flat seams to minimize chafing.
  • Collars and Sleeves: Ensure they do not restrict movement or cause irritation.

Performance Features

Moisture-Wicking

  • Essential for keeping you dry and comfortable during intense activities. Look for terms like “moisture-wicking,” “quick-dry,” or specific brand technologies.

Breathability

  • Mesh panels or ventilation zones can enhance airflow, preventing overheating.

Flexibility

  • Materials like spandex provide stretchability, allowing for a full range of motion. This is particularly important in sports that require dynamic movements.

Durability and Maintenance

Stitching Quality

  • Check for reinforced stitching, especially in high-stress areas like shoulders and sides. This ensures longevity and withstands the rigors of sports.

Care Instructions

  • Follow the manufacturer’s care instructions to maintain the jersey’s quality. Most high-performance jerseys require gentle washing and air drying to preserve fabric integrity.
